News – Masters Road Race Championships

The first ever separate National Women’s Masters Road Race Championship is set to be a great success. This follows the success of the Women’s Olympics team, and their continued success on both road and track, and reflecting the growth of interest in Women’s cycle racing generally. The race takes place near Milton Keynes on Sunday 8th June with a field of close to 50 riders which is 200% up on two years ago, when just 16 Women rode alongside the male 60+ age group.

We are delighted that Paralympian super star Dame Sarah Storey has recently entered the field along with one of her team mates, Nicola Juniper, of the newly created Pearl Izumi-Sports International Tours team. With the likes of Natalie Creswick, Alexis Shaw, Laura Massey and Eleanor Jones also in the field, it is set for an exciting race over a sporting course.

A “dark horse” may be Jenny Copnall John, who lives locally to the course. Jenny is an ex professional MTB champion winning 6 British Championships and 15 Championship medals over her career. This event is one of six Masters races over the weekend of 7 and 8 June, with 300 riders competing from all over the country. This is a 60% increase on two years ago, when these championships were last held, and reflects the increasing interest and competitiveness across age groups.

Riders from all over the UK will be converging on the small village of Wing where six races will take place over the weekend. The races are based on five year age groups and begin at 30. On Saturday 7th June there are 4 races for Males aged 40-60+, whilst on Sunday 8th June there are the Male (30-39) and Women’s races, with each day’s racing starting at 0830.

Early on we could see that we were massively oversubscribed in the 40-49 age group, so we have created an extra race to the original program. And we are currently addressing a similar situation for the 50-59 year age group.
